Biografia

Lil B, real name Brandon Christopher McCartney, is an American rapper born in Berkeley, California, in 1989. Known for his unique and experimental style, Lil B gained popularity in the 2010s thanks to the "Based" movement, a philosophy that promotes unconditional love, positivity, and self-acceptance. His musical genre is a mix of hip hop, alternative rap, and electronic music, often characterized by introspective and spiritual lyrics. Among his most famous songs are "Swag Like Ohio", "I'm God", and "Wonton Soup". Lil B has collaborated with artists such as Tyler, the Creator and A$AP Rocky. His music has been influenced by various musical cultures, including funk, soul, and classical music. Lil B is considered an underground icon and a controversial figure in the world of rap.
